Creativity and New Media

For this assignment, I decided to use a different form of new media that we have yet to discuss in class and that was video games. Online video games offer a rich community composed of people from all different walks of life, who come together to share their interests in the latest games and trends. In order to complete this assignment, I signed on to my X-box 360 and created a virtual avatar (similar to what you do Second Life).
                Although a little difficult, I attempted to make my avatar resemble myself as closely as possible. After this I began to play games and tried to meet as many new people as possible. After playing with a few different people, I began using a great tool by X-box that allows you to see players who you have recently played with and either message them or add them as “friends.” Soon enough, I entered a chat room through the video game system and began talking to a group of gamers. One of the members suggested I try a game called “Crash Course.” In the game you use your avatar to compete against others in a challenging obstacle course, the idea slightly resembles the popular show “Wipeout.”  


                In this game I was able to meet and talk to a number of different people, as well as see and compete against their personal avatars. Soon enough, I added them to my network of video game friends. We also exchanged Facebook and Twitter usernames, so we were able to connect through more than one medium. This assignment was a lot fun to complete and much different from anything I was used to, as it allowed me the opportunity to do something that I enjoy.  I was also fortunate enough to meet a number of different people who introduced me to new games, ideas, and upcoming events and trends. This is a perfect example of how social media fosters creativity, as it creates an environment where strangers can become friends and ideas and information may be shared, expanded upon, and passed to all.
